Output 68b67901a89edd5c99f5e24cf10e0fbb5e923782adf01bd9662cb5d458e0a50b:129

value
1583764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03aa1ee0f315595a3fb62a893e20dccf461a5866 OP_EQUAL
address
D5UUN2DgQcAFQEbTQ2hQC9uGwUmGZ5EZNt
transaction
68b67901a89edd5c99f5e24cf10e0fbb5e923782adf01bd9662cb5d458e0a50b
spent
true